SUPER-CU COPPER FUNGICIDE
- EPA Reg No: 1812-241
- Registrant: GRIFFIN L.L.C.
- Signal word: Caution
- Active ingredients: Basic copper sulfate (23.85%)
- Label accepted: 1982-10-14
- Source PDF: https://www3.epa.gov/pesticides/chem_search/ppls/001812-00241-19821014.pdf

• , I , • I • SUPER CU, Copper Fungicide EPA REG. NO. 1812-241 Supplemental Labeling Pears: Pseudomonas Blight - Apply Super cu before fall rains at a rate of 2 - 3~ quarts per 100 gallons of water and again at dormant before spring growth starts.
